## 2024-xx Changelog — Bouncehawk key rotation

Rotated the signing key for the Bouncehawk email bounce processor after the quarterly audit flagged the old one as past its 90-day window. All workers in the Tellvik cluster have been restarted and are verifying bounce webhooks with the new key. Old key remains valid until Friday 18:00, then it's revoked for good. If you see signature mismatch alerts after that, check that the consumer picked up the new key. Current signing key is below.

deploy key for kajof-fajop: bky6_gDHw9Q

**FAQ: What are the loading dock delivery hours?**

The dock at Ostler Row accepts deliveries 07:00–15:30, weekdays only. Contractors must book a slot with Facilities the day before. No parking on the ramp; unload and move on. Out-of-hours deliveries are refused unless pre-approved. The dock shutter is staff-operated, but the pedestrian door beside it is keypad-controlled for approved contractors. If your visit is approved, use the code below.

turnstile pass: bdg-FVNQRS-72965873

## Changelog: Broker Upgrade, Renamed Setting

As part of the Harrowtide 3.0 broker upgrade, the old setting `MQ_CONN` was renamed to `BROKER_URL` to match upstream conventions. The legacy name is no longer read, so please update any local env files carefully — silent fallbacks were removed on purpose. The broker now also requires an authentication credential at startup, supplied via the line below:

sealed setting: ARCHIVE_KEY3=8d0